Abstract
ETHNOPHARMACOLOGICAL RELEVANCE Alcohol misuse persists as a prevalent societal concern and precipitates diverse deleterious consequences, entailing significant associated health hazards including acute alcohol intoxication (AAI). Binge drinking, a commonplace pattern of alcohol consumption, may incite neurodegeneration and neuronal dysfunction. Clinicians tasked with managing AAI confront a dearth of pharmaceutical intervention alternatives. In contrast, natural products have garnered interest due to their compatibility with the human body and fewer side effects. Lingjiao Gouteng decoction (LGD), a classical traditional Chinese medicine decoction, represents a frequently employed prescription in cases of encephalopathy, although its efficacy in addressing acute alcoholism and alcohol-induced brain injury remains inadequately investigated. AIM OF THE STUDY To investigate the conceivable therapeutic benefits of LGD in AAI and alcohol-induced brain injury, while delving into the underlying fundamental mechanisms involved. MATERIALS AND METHODS We established an AAI mouse model through alcohol gavage, and LGD was administered to the mice twice at the 2 h preceding and 30 min subsequent to alcohol exposure. The study encompassed the utilization of the loss of righting reflex assay, histopathological analysis, enzyme-linked immunosorbent assays, and cerebral tissue biochemical assays to investigate the impact of LGD on AAI and alcohol-induced brain injury. These assessments included a comprehensive evaluation of various biomarkers associated with the inflammatory response and oxidative stress. Finally, RT-qPCR, Western blot, and immunofluorescence staining were carried out to explore the underlying mechanisms through which LGD exerts its therapeutic influence, potentially through the regulation of the RhoA/ROCK2/NF-κB signaling pathway. RESULTS Our investigation underscores the therapeutic efficacy of LGD in ameliorating AAI, as evidenced by discernible alterations in the loss of righting reflex assay, pathological analysis, and assessment of inflammatory and oxidative stress biomarkers. Furthermore, the results of RT-qPCR, Western blot, and immunofluorescence staining manifest a noteworthy regulatory effect of LGD on the RhoA/ROCK2/NF-κB signaling pathway. CONCLUSIONS The present study confirmed the therapeutic potential of LGD in AAI and alcohol-induced brain injury, and the protective effects of LGD against alcohol-induced brain injury may be intricately linked to the RhoA/ROCK2/NF-κB signaling pathway.

Abstract
ETHNOPHARMACOLOGICAL RELEVANCE Coronavirus Disease 2019 (COVID-19) is a grave and pervasive global infectious malady brought about by Severe Acute Respiratory Syndrome Coronavirus 2 (SARS-CoV-2), posing a significant menace to human well-being. Qingfei Paidu decoction (QFPD) represents a pioneering formulation derived from four classical Chinese medicine prescriptions. Substantiated evidence attests to its efficacy in alleviating clinical manifestations, mitigating the incidence of severe and critical conditions, and reducing mortality rates among COVID-19 patients. AIM OF THE STUDY This study aims to investigate the protection effects of QFPD in mice afflicted with a coronavirus infection, with a particular focus on determining whether its mechanism involves the NLRP3 signaling pathway. MATERIALS AND METHODS The coronavirus mice model was established through intranasal infection of Kunming mice with Hepatic Mouse Virus A59 (MHV-A59). In the dose-effect experiment, normal saline, ribavirin (80 mg/kg), or QFPD (5, 10, 20 g/kg) were administered to the mice 2 h following MHV-A59 infection. In the time-effect experiment, normal saline or QFPD (20 g/kg) was administered to mice 2 h post MHV-A59 infection. Following the assessment of mouse body weights, food consumption, and water intake, intragastric administration was conducted once daily at consistent intervals over a span of 5 days. The impact of QFPD on pathological alterations in the livers and lungs of MHV-A59-infected mice was evaluated through H&E staining. The viral loads of MHV-A59 in both the liver and lung were determined using qPCR. The expression levels of genes and proteins related to the NLRP3 pathway in the liver and lung were assessed through qPCR, Western Blot analysis, and immunofluorescence. RESULTS The administration of QFPD was shown to ameliorate the reduced weight gain, decline in food consumption, and diminished water intake, all of which were repercussions of MHV-A59 infection in mice. QFPD treatment exhibited notable efficacy in safeguarding tissue integrity. The extent of hepatic and pulmonary injury, when coupled with QFPD treatment, demonstrated not only a reduction with higher treatment dosages but also a decline with prolonged treatment duration. In the dose-effect experiment, there was a notable, dose-dependent reduction in the viral loads, as well as the expression levels of IL-1β, NLRP3, ASC, Caspase 1, Caspase-1 p20, GSDMD, GSDMD-N, and NF-κB within the liver of the QFPD-treated groups. Additionally, in the time-effects experiments, the viral loads and the expression levels of genes and proteins linked to the NLRP3 pathway were consistently lower in the QFPD-treated groups compared with the model control groups, particularly during the periods when their expressions reached their zenith in the model group. Notably, IL-18 showed only a modest elevation relative to the blank control group following QFPD treatment. CONCLUSIONS To sum up, our current study demonstrated that QFPD treatment has the capacity to alleviate infection-related symptoms, mitigate tissue damage in infected organs, and suppress viral replication in coronavirus-infected mice. The protective attributes of QFPD in coronavirus-infected mice are plausibly associated with its modulation of the NLRP3 signaling pathway. We further infer that QFPD holds substantial promise in the context of coronavirus infection therapy.

Abstract
BACKGROUND Recurrent spontaneous abortion affects approximately 1-2% of reproductive-age women, with roughly half of RSA cases classified as unexplained recurrent spontaneous abortion (URSA). Genetic polymorphisms in eNOS gene have been shown to have significant implications across various disease processes. Nevertheless, the potential impact of eNOS gene polymorphisms on the susceptibility to URSA in Yunnan population has yet to be explored or documented. OBJECTIVE This study aims to investigate the potential association between specific variations in the eNOS gene (VNTR 4b/a, -786T > C, and +894G > T) and the risk of URSA in Yunnan population. METHODS A total of 243 URSA patients and 241 healthy females are involved in this study. We conducted amplification of the eNOS gene fragment and performed sanger sequencing to detect the specific eNOS gene polymorphisms, including VNTR 4b/a, -786T > C, and +894G > T. Using a multivariate logistic regression model, we evaluate the potential association between eNOS gene polymorphisms (VNTR 4b/a, -786T > C, and +894G > T) and the risk of URSA. Furthermore, serum NO levels were measured in URSA patients. RESULTS The presence of VNTR 4a, -786C, and +894T alleles was found to be associated with an increased risk of URSA. Additionally, our study revealed a significant association between the G-C-4b haplotype of the investigated eNOS gene polymorphisms and a predisposition to URSA. Notably, these eNOS polymorphisms were shown to reduce serum NO levels in URSA patients. CONCLUSION This study provides evidence supporting the association between eNOS gene polymorphisms, VNTR 4b/a, -786T > C, and +894G > T, and the occurrence of URSA in Yunnan Province, China.

Abstract
Pulmonary fibrosis (PF) is a lethal disease characterized by a progressive decline in lung function. Currently, lung transplantation remains the only available treatment for PF. However, both artemisinin (ART) and hydroxychloroquine (HCQ) possess potential antifibrotic properties. This study aimed to investigate the effects and mechanisms of a compound known as Artemisinin-Hydroxychloroquine (AH) in treating PF, specifically by targeting the TGF-β1/Smad2/3 pathway. To do this, we utilized an animal model of PF induced by a single tracheal drip of bleomycin (BLM) in Sprague-Dawley (SD) rats. The PF animal models were administered various doses of AH, and the efficacy and safety of AH were evaluated through pulmonary function testing, blood routine tests, serum biochemistry tests, organ index measurements, and pathological examinations. Additionally, Elisa, western blotting, and qPCR techniques were employed to explore the potential molecular mechanisms of AH in treating PF. Our findings reveal that AH effectively and safely alleviate PF by inhibiting BLM-induced specific inflammation, reducing extracellular matrix (ECM) deposition, and interfering with the TGF-β1/Smad2/3 signaling pathway. Notably, the windfall for this study is that the inhibition of ECM may initiate self-healing in the BLM-induced PF animal model. In conclusion, AH shows promise as a potential therapeutic drug for PF, as it inhibits disease progression through the TGF-β1/Smad2/3 signaling pathway.

Abstract
The automatic inflow control device (AICD) used for water control and gas recovery in gas wells as the core component of gas well intelligent layered/segmented production and water control technology is very important for the development of advanced well completion (AWC) technology in water-producing gas reservoirs. Therefore, the design of AICD to ensure that the gas flows smoothly inside it and to keep water under control to a greater extent can maximize the performance of the AICD, and the most important thing is to restrict the water in the formation from entering the wellbore. However, currently, there are very few designs and research on the AICD used for water control and gas production in the gas wells, and the performance of this type of tool and the law of gas and water flow inside it are not perfect, so more in-depth research is needed. In this paper, a new type of AICD is designed to realize the function of water control and gas flow smoothly, and the DoE of the new AICD is carried out, determining the factors that will affect the key technical indicators and the factors that may have interactive effects, using the numerical simulation method of computational fluid dynamics to carry out optimal design, conducting fluid physical property sensitivity analysis, and flow rate applicability analysis. The results show that the tool is not sensitive to the viscosity of water and gas in different gas reservoirs but is very sensitive to the density of water and gas. When the gas/water flow rate ratio is less than 4, it can exert its water control effect. In addition, the results of multiple sets of physical experiments are well consistent with the simulation results; the average deviation of single-phase water is 10.91% and the average deviation of single-phase gas is 11.85%. Computational fluid dynamics and physical experiment results show that, under these conditions, the difference in fluid flow characteristics can be fully exploited; the channel is automatically identified to produce a small gas pressure drop and a large water flow pressure drop. The research in this paper belongs to the key technology of the AWC technology of gas wells in the new water control strategy of the current and has a certain reference value to make up for the defects of drainage gas recovery technology in the water management strategy..

Abstract
OBJECTIVE Observational studies have posited a strong correlation between chronic gastritis (CG) and major depressive disorder (MDD), but the nature of this association remains uncertain, owing to the challenges of establishing the temporal sequence. The present study sought to elucidate the elusive relationship between CG and MDD by employing a bidirectional two-sample Mendelian randomization (MR) approach. METHODS We extracted instrumental variants for MDD and CG from published genome-wide association study data, focusing on individuals of primarily European descent. A comprehensive suite of MR estimations and sensitivity analyses was performed to ensure the robustness of the findings. Each outcome database was analyzed separately in both directions. RESULTS For MDD and CG, 221 and 5 genetic variants, respectively, were selectively extracted as instrumental variants. The results suggest that MDD is causally associated with an elevated risk of CG (IVW: 23andMe, OR = 1.33; 95% CI = 1.15-1.54; p = 1.06 × 10-4); conversely, no strong evidence was found to corroborate that CG exerts a causal effect on the incidence of MDD (IVW: OR = 1.01; 95% CI = 0.95-1.07; p = 0.68). CONCLUSIONS These findings provide novel insights into the causal relationship between CG and MDD, which may have implications for clinical decision-making in patients with MDD and CG.

Abstract
Objective: To analyze the clinical characteristics and treatment of middle ear myoclonus. Methods: Fifty-six cases of middle ear myoclonus were enrolled in Shandong Provincial ENT Hospital, Shandong University from September 2019 to August 2021, including 23 males and 33 females. The age ranged from 6 to 75 years, with a median age of 35 years; Forty-seven cases were unilateral tinnitus, nine cases were bilateral tinnitus. The time of tinnitus ranged from 20 days to 8 years. The voice characteristics, inducing factors, nature (frequency) of tinnitus, tympanic membrane conditions during tinnitus, audiological related tests, including long-term acoustic tympanogram, stapedius acoustic reflex, pure tone auditory threshold, short increment sensitivity test, alternate binaural loudness balance test, loudness discomfort threshold, vestibular function examination, facial electromyography, and imaging examination were recorded. Oral carbamazepine and/or surgical treatment were used. The patients were followed up for 6-24 months and the tinnitus changes were observed. Results: Tinnitus was diverse, including stepping on snow liking sound, rhythmic drumming, white noise, and so on. The inducing factors included external sound, body position change, touching the skin around the face and ears, speaking, chewing and blinking, etc. Forty-four cases were induced by single factor and 9 cases were induced by two or more factors. There was no definite inducing factor in 1 case. One patient had tinnitus with epilepsy. One case of traumatic facial paralysis after facial nerve decompression could induce tinnitus on the affected side when the auricle moved. Tympanic membrane flutter with the same frequency as tinnitus was found in 12 cases by otoscopy, and the waveform with the same frequency as tinnitus was found by long-term tympanogram examination. There were 7 patients with no tympanic membrane activity by otoscopy, the 7 cases also with the same frequency of tinnitus by long-term tympanogram examination, but the change rate of the waveform was faster than that of the patients with tympanic membrane flutter. All patients with tinnitus had no change in hearing. One case of tinnitus complicated with epilepsy (a 6-year-old child) was treated with antiepileptic drug (topiramate) and tinnitus subsided. One case suffered from tinnitus after facial nerve decompression for traumatic facial paralysis was not given special treatment. Fifty-four cases were treated with oral drug (carbamazepine), of which 10 cases were completely controlled and 23 cases were relieved; 21 cases were invalid. Among the 21 patients with no effect of carbamazepine treatment, 8 patients were treated by surgery, 7 patients had no tinnitus after surgery, 1 patient received three times of operation, and the third operation was followed up for 6 months, no tinnitus occurred again. The other 13 cases refused the surgical treatment due to personal reasons. Conclusions: Middle ear myoclonus tinnitus and the inducing factors manifestate diversity. Oral carbamazepine and other sedative drugs are effective for some patients, and surgical treatment is feasible for those who are ineffective for medication.

Abstract
The molecular detection of SARS-CoV-2 is extremely important for the discovery and prevention of pandemic dissemination. Because SARS-CoV-2 is not always present in the samples that can be collected, the sample chosen for testing has inevitably become the key to the SARS-CoV-2 positive cases screening. The nucleotide amplification strategy mainly includes Q-PCR assays and isothermal amplification assays. The Q-PCR assay is the most used SARS-CoV-2 detection assay. Due to heavy expenditures and other drawbacks, isothermal amplification cannot replace the dominant position of the Q-PCR assay. The antibody-based detection combined with Q-PCR can help to find more positive cases than only using nucleotide amplification-based assays. Pooled testing based on Q-PCR significantly increases efficiency and reduces the cost of massive-scale screening. The endless stream of variants emerging across the world poses a great challenge to SARS-CoV-2 molecular detection. The multi-target assays and several other strategies have proved to be efficient in the detection of mutated SARS-CoV-2 variants. Further research work should concentrate on: (1) identifying more ideal sample plucking strategies, (2) ameliorating the Q-PCR primer and probes targeted toward mutated SARS-CoV-2 variants, (3) exploring more economical and precise isothermal amplification assays, and (4) developing more advanced strategies for antibody/antigen or engineered antibodies to ameliorate the antibody/antigen-based strategy.

Abstract
Modified Lvdou Gancao decoction (MLG), a traditional Chinese medicine formula, has been put into clinical use to treat the diseases of the digestive system for a long run, showing great faculty in gastric protection and anti-inflammatory, whereas its protective mechanisms have not been determined. The current study puts the focus on the protective effect and its possible mechanisms of MLG on ethanol-induced gastric lesions in mice. In addition to various gastric lesion parameters and histopathology analysis, the activities of a list of relevant indicators in gastric mucosa were explored including ALDH, ADH, MDA, T-SOD, GSH-Px, and MPO, and the mechanisms were clarified using RT-qPCR, ELISA Western Blot and immunofluorescence staining. The results showed that MLG treatment induced significant increment of ADH, ALDH, T-SOD, GSH-Px, NO, PGE2 and SS activities in gastric tissues, while MPO, MDA, TNF-α and IL-1β levels were on the decline, both in a dose-dependent manner. In contrast to the model group, the mRNA expression of Nrf-2 and HO-1 in the MLG treated groups showed an upward trend while the NF-κB, TNFα, IL-1β and COX2 in the MLG treated groups had a downward trend simultaneously. Furthermore, the protein levels of p65, p-p65, IκBα, p-IκBα, iNOS, COX2 and p38 were inhibited, while Nrf2, HO-1, SOD1, SOD2 and eNOS were ramped up in MLG treatment groups. Immunofluorescence intensities of Nrf2 and HO-1 in the MLG treated groups were considerably enhanced, with p65 and IκBα diminished simultaneously, exhibiting similar trends to that of qPCR and western blot. To sum up, MLG could significantly ameliorate ethanol-induced gastric mucosal lesions in mice, which might be put down to the activation of alcohol metabolizing enzymes, attenuation of the oxidative damage and inflammatory response to maintain the gastric mucosa. The gastroprotective effect of MLG might be achieved through the diminution of damage factors and the enhancement of defensive factors involving NF-κB/Nrf2/HO-1 signaling pathway. We further confirmed that MLG has strong potential in preventing and treating ethanol-induced gastric lesions.

Abstract
Nuclear factor of activated T cells 1 (NFATc1) is mainly expressed in tumor microenvironment, especially in macrophages. However, whether NFATc1 is involved in the polarization of tumor associated macrophages (TAMs) and tumor progression in cervical cancer (CC) remains unclear. Immunofluorescence staining was used to detect the expression of CD68 and NFATc1 in CC tissues or adjacent normal tissues of patients. RT-qPCR, flow cytometry, ELISA, and inhibitors treatment were used to observe the effect of NFATc1 on TAMs polarization. Clonal formation, scratch, and transwell assays were used to examine the effects of NFATc1-transfected macrophages or NFATc1-transfected TAM on tumor proliferation, migration, and invasion. Further, a xenograft model was established to confirm the roles of NFATc1+ TAM in CC tumorigenesis. NFATc1+CD68+/CD68+ TAMs ratio was significantly increased in CC tissues compared with the normal tissue, and NFATc1+ TAM showed an M2-like TAM subtype. NFATc1 induced macrophages to secrete IL-10, which further induced M2 polarization of macrophages. Mechanically, the c-myc-PKM2 pathway mediated the expression of IL-10 in NFATc1-induced macrophages. Functionally, NFATc1 induced M2 macrophages promoted the proliferation, migration, and invasion of CC cells, and the knockout of NFATc1 in TAMs significantly inhibited the tumor-promoting function of TAMs. Further, the tumorigenesis test in nude mice confirmed that NFATc1+ TAM promoted the tumorigenicity of CC cells in vivo. In conclusion, NFATc1 mediated IL-10 secretion by regulating the c-myc/PKM2 pathway, thereby induce M2 polarization of TAMs and promote the progression of CC.

Abstract
Objective: This study aims to investigate the clinical efficacy of laparoscopy and hysteroscopy in the treatment of tubal-factor infertility (TFI) to provide a basis for predicting postoperative pregnancy rates. Methods: The clinical data of 336 patients who underwent laparoscopy and hysteroscopy for TFI between February 2018 and December 2018 in the Department of Reproductive Gynecology at the First People's Hospital of Yunnan were retrospectively analyzed. After implementing the inclusion and exclusion criteria, 278 patients were included in the study. The patients were grouped according to pelvic adhesions, hydrosalpinx, twisted fallopian tubes, and fimbriae structure. The impact of the extent of fallopian tube diseases on postoperative pregnancy outcomes was analyzed. Results: Of the 278 patients, 129 got pregnant (pregnancy rate = 46.4%). Pelvic adhesions, hydrosalpinx, twisted/folded fallopian tubes, and damage to the fimbriae of the fallopian tubes were found to affect the natural pregnancy rate after surgery, and it decreased significantly with the aggravation of the disease (P < 0.001). Of the 129 patients who had natural pregnancies, 29 had ectopic pregnancies (ectopic pregnancy rate = 22.48%). Twisted/folded fallopian tubes and damage to the fimbriae structure significantly increased the incidence of postoperative ectopic pregnancy (P < 0.001). Conclusion: Laparoscopy and hysteroscopy are effective treatments for TFI. Pelvic adhesions, twisted/folded fallopian tubes, hydrosalpinx, and damage to the fimbriae of the fallopian tubes can affect postoperative pregnancy outcomes and lead to failure of a natural pregnancy after the operation. The incidence of ectopic pregnancy increases with the degree of fallopian tube twisting/folding and the degree of damage to the fimbriae of the fallopian tubes.

Abstract
AIMS Gut microbial alterations have great potential to predict the development of colorectal cancer (CRC); however, how gut microbes respond to the development of CRC in males and females at the community level is unknown. We aim to investigate the differences of gut microbiota between the male and female. METHODS AND RESULTS We reanalysed the dataset in a published project from a sex perspective at the community level by characterizing the gut microbiome in patients (including males and females) from three clinical groups representative of the stages of CRC development: healthy, adenoma, and carcinoma. The results indicated that the microbial α-diversity showed no significant difference in the male gut but had decreased significantly in the female gut with the development of CRC. In males, a significant difference in the microbial β-diversity was only observed between the healthy and carcinoma subgroups. However, significant community deviations were detected with the development of CRC in females. The microbial community assembly processes changed from deterministic to stochastic in males, whereas they became increasingly deterministic in females with the development of CRC. Moreover microbial co-occurrence associations tended to be more complicated in males; rare species were enriched in the co-occurrence network of the male gut, whereas key species loss was observed in the co-occurrence network of the female gut. CONCLUSIONS The microbial communities in the male gut were more stable than those in the female gut, and microbial community assembly in the gut was sex dependent with the development of CRC. Our study suggests that sexual dimorphism needs to be considered to better predict the risk of CRC based on microbial shifts. SIGNIFICANCE AND IMPACT OF THE STUDY To the best of our knowledge, this is the first report showing how gut microbes respond to the development of CRC in males and females at the community scale.

Abstract
BACKGROUND This study aims to investigate the influencing factors of pregnancy after laparoscopic oviduct anastomosis. METHODS The data of 156 cases of laparoscopic oviduct anastomosis in our hospital were analyzed. RESULTS The pregnancy rate decreased with age (P < 0.005). The pregnancy rate after six years of anastomosis was higher in those with ligation (P < 0.005). The postoperative pregnancy rate significantly increased in subjects with oviduct lengths of > 7 cm (P < 0.01). The pregnancy rate of isthmus end-to-end anastomosis was higher (P < 0.005). The pregnancy rate after bilateral tubal recanalization was higher than that after unilateral tubal recanalization (P < 0.005). The pregnancy rate after laparoscopic tubal ligation and laparoscopic anastomosis was higher than that of open tubal ligation and laparoscopic anastomosis (P < 0.005). CONCLUSION The pregnancy rate after laparoscopic oviduct anastomosis is higher in subjects below 35 years old, with a ligation duration of < 6 years, and a length of oviduct of > 7 cm, and those who underwent isthmus anastomosis and laparoscopic oviduct ligation and recanalization.

Abstract
OBJECTIVE The relationship between cognitive function and dietary intake in older adults was under-studied in China. This study examined this relationship in a Chinese sample while controlling for the effects of sleep quality and socio demographic confounders. METHODS The sample consisted of 340 Chinese older adults (age > 60) who were randomly selected from Wuhan city in central China. Cognitive function was assessed by the Mini-mental State Examination [MMSE], sleep quality by the Pittsburgh Sleep Quality Index [PSQI], and dietary intake by frequencies of intake of meat products, fruits, fish/seafood/aquatic products, nuts and mushroom/algae over the past year. First, confirmatory factor analysis (CFA) was conducted to evaluate the measurement properties of cognitive function, dietary intake, and sleep quality. Second, structural equation modeling (SEM) was conducted to examine the relations of cognitive function, dietary intake, and sleep quality. RESULTS Dietary intake was found to be positively related to cognitive function. Older age, lower education status, monthly income, and living alone or without a spouse were significantly associated with poorer cognitive function. SES status had an indirect effect on cognitive function via dietary intake. CONCLUSION Dietary intake may be critical to maintain normal cognitive function of older adults in China.

Abstract
Monoterpene synthases carry out complex reactions to produce multiple products from a sole substrate, geranyl pyrophosphate (GPP). S-limonene synthase (LS) is a model monoterpene synthase that can be explored to understand the catalytic mechanism of these enzymes. In this study, we have identified an active site tyrosine residue (Y573) is crucial for the enzyme activity and mutational analysis indicates that both the aromatic ring and hydroxyl group are essential for the catalysis. Dynamic simulations found a hydrogen bond between Y573 and D496 and also a significant conformational change in the helical form of the LPP intermediate. Further mutagenesis suggested that this hydrogen bond is essential for catalysis. Sequence analysis suggested Y573 is completely conserved among cyclic monoterpene synthases but variable in acyclic enzymes, indicating this residue may be involved in cyclization. Subsequent studies by using neryl diphosphate (NPP) as the substrate ruled out the possibility that Y573 functions solely at the substrate isomerization step. Therefore, a more complicated role may be played by this residue. We proposed that Y573 may be involved in the earlier steps of the reaction, probably by controlling the conformation of the helical LPP intermediate. Our study provides important insights not only on the catalytic mechanism of LS, but also on the cyclization of monoterpene synthases in general.

Abstract
Using grand-canonical Monte Carlo (GCMC) simulations, we investigate the isotropic-nematic phase transition for hard rods of size L×1×1 on a three-dimensional cubic lattice. We observe such a transition for L≥6. For L=6, the nematic state has a negative order parameter, reflecting the co-occurrence of two dominating orientations. For L≥7, the nematic state has a positive order parameter, corresponding to the dominance of one orientation. We investigate rod lengths up to L=25 and find evidence for a very weakly first-order isotropic-nematic transition, while we cannot completely rule out a second-order transition. It was not possible to detect a density jump at the transition, despite using large systems containing several 10^{5} particles. The probability density distributions P(Q) from the GCMC simulations near the transition are very broad, pointing to strong fluctuations. Our results complement earlier results on the demixing (pseudonematic) transition for an equivalent system in two dimensions, which is presumably of Ising type and occurs for L≥7. We compare our results to lattice fundamental measure theory (FMT) and find that FMT strongly overestimates nematic order and consequently predicts a strong first-order transition. The rod packing fraction of the nematic coexisting states, however, agree reasonably well between FMT and GCMC.

Abstract
S-limonene synthase is a model monoterpene synthase that cyclizes geranyl pyrophosphate (GPP) to form S-limonene. It is a relatively specific enzyme as the majority of its products are composed of limonene. In this study, we converted it to pinene or phellandrene synthases after introducing N345A/L423A/S454A or N345I mutations. Further studies on N345 suggest the polarity of this residue plays a critical role in limonene production by stabilizing the terpinyl cation intermediate. If it is mutated to a non-polar residue, further cyclization or hydride shifts occurs so the carbocation migrates towards the pyrophosphate, leading to the production of pinene or phellandrene. On the other hand, mutant enzymes that still possess a polar residue at this position produce limonene as the major product. N345 is not the only polar residue that may stabilize the terpinyl cation because it is not strictly conserved among limonene synthases across species and there are also several other polar residues in this area. These residues could form a "polar pocket" that may collectively play this stabilizing role. Our study provides important insights into the catalytic mechanism of limonene synthases. Furthermore, it also has wider implications on the evolution of terpene synthases.

Abstract
Objective:To investigate the ultrahigh-frequency(UHF) hearing thresholds in middle-aged and elderly healthy subjects .Method: Healthy subjects(age range: 50-69 ) were divided into two groups,i.e.50-59 year-old group and >59-69 year-old group.Each subject was tested with both conventional-frequency(0.25,0.50,1.00,2.00,4.00,6.00 and 8.00 kHz) and ultrahigh-frequency(9.0,10.0,11.5,12.5,14.0,16.0,18.0,and 20.0 kHz) audiometry.UHF was performed twice to evaluate the reliability.The best hearings among 20-29 aged healthy adults were considered as normal controls.Results:Seventy five middle-aged and elderly subjects were included,with 39 subjects(78 ears) being 50-59 years old and 36(72 ears) being >59-69 year-old.Eighteen subjects(36 ears) aging from 20 to 29 were considers as controls.For the conventional-frequency,the hearing thresholds in middle-aged and elderly people were significantly higher than those in young people(all P<0.05),especially at ≥4 kHz.Although the conventional-frequency thresholds in >59-69 year-old group were higher than those in 50-59 year-old,the difference was significant just at 4 kHz(P<0.05).The UHF thresholds in middle-aged and elderly people were significantly higher than those in young people(all P<0.05).The thresholds at 9,10,11.5 and 12.5 kHz in >59-69 year-old people were significantly increased than those in 50-59 year-old counterparts(all P<0.05).Hearing threshold at ≥12.5 kHz couldn't be detected in some subjects in middle-aged and elderly group.The response rate at UHF in >59-69 year-old people were just higher than that in 50-59 year-old counterparts (P>0.05),and none responded at 18 and 20 kHz.The standard deviations(SDs) for <14 kHz in 50-59 year-old and for <11.5 kHz in >59-69 year-old subjects,were both higher than that in 20-29 year old counterparts.Above 6 kHz,the SDs in 50-59 year-old subjects were significantly higher than those in >59-69 year-old subjects(all P<0.05).Conclusion:For middle-aged and elderly people,the hearing loss may occur from 4 kHz.Hearing thresholds at UHF were increased with age,and it might be used as an early indicator for age-induced hearing loss.However,the UHF sensitivity decreased as the frequency increased beyond 14 kHz.

Abstract
OBJECTIVE To observe the difference in clinical efficacy on focal vitiligo treated with heat-sensitive moxibustion in comparison with medication, and discuss its effect mechanism. METHODS Sixty-eight cases were randomized into a moxibustion group (38 cases) and a medication group (30 cases). Additionally, 20 healthy persons were selected randomly as a normal group. In the moxibustion group, the heat-sensitive moxibustion was applied to Hegu(LI 4), Quchi(LI 11), Yanglingquan(GB 34), Zusanli(ST 36), Xuehai(SP 10) and the others, once a day. In the medication group, triamcinolone acetonide cream was used externally and locally, twice a day. In the two groups, the treatment of 15 days made one session. The efficacy was observed after continuous treatment for 3 sessions. The hemorheology test was done in all of the subjects. The radioimmunoassay was adopted to determine the levels of Interleukin 2 (IL-2), Interleukin 6 (IL-6), Interleukin 10 (IL-10) and tumor necrosis factor (TNF-alpha) before and after treatment. RESULTS The levels of IL-6, IL-10 and TNF-alpha in vitiligo patients were higher significantly than those in the normal group (P<0. 01, P<0. 05), the level of IL-2 was lower significantly than that in the normal group (P<0. 01) before treatment. After 3 sessions treatment, IL-2 level was increased significantly in the moxibustion group and the levels of IL-6, IL-10 and TNF-alpha were reduced, without significant differences as compared with the normal group (all P>0. 05). But the differences were significant as compared with those in the medication group (all P<0. 05). The curative and remarkably effective rate was 76. 3% (29/38) after treatment in the moxibustion group, which was higher significantly than 13. 3% (4/30, P<0. 05) in the medication group. CONCLUSION Heat-sensitive moxibustion achieves very good clinical efficacy on focal vitiligo, which is probably via promoting blood circulation and regulating the levels of IL-6, IL-10 and TNF-alpha.

Abstract
While Parkinson's disease is the result of dopaminergic dysfunction of the nigrostriatal system, the clinical manifestations of Parkinson's disease are brought about by alterations in multiple neural components, including cortical areas. We examined how 1-methyl-4-phenyl-1,2,3,6-tetrahydropyridine (MPTP) administration affected extracellular cortical glutamate levels by comparing glutamate levels in normal and MPTP-lesioned nonhuman primates (Macaca mulatta). Extracellular glutamate levels were measured using glutamate microelectrode biosensors. Unilateral MPTP-administration rendered the animals with hemiparkinsonian symptoms, including dopaminergic deficiencies in the substantia nigra and the premotor and motor cortices, and with statistically significant decreases in basal glutamate levels in the primary motor cortex on the side ipsilateral to the MPTP-lesion. These results suggest that the functional changes of the glutamatergic system, especially in the motor cortex, in models of Parkinson's disease could provide important insights into the mechanisms of this disease.

Abstract
The neurorestorative effects of exogenous neurturin (NTN) delivered directly into the putamen via multiport catheters were studied in 10 MPTP-lesioned rhesus monkeys expressing stable parkinsonism. The parkinsonian animals were blindly assigned to receive coded solutions containing either vehicle (n = 5) or NTN (n = 5, 30 μg/day). Both solutions were coinfused with heparin using convection-enhanced delivery for 3 months. The NTN recipients showed a significant and sustained behavioral improvement in their parkinsonian features during the treatment period, an effect not seen in the vehicle-treated animals. At study termination, locomotor activity levels were increased by 50% in the NTN versus vehicle recipients. Also, DOPAC levels were significantly increased by 150% ipsilateral (right) to NTN infusion in the globus pallidus, while HVA levels were elevated bilaterally in the NTN-treated animals by 10% on the left and 67% on the right hemisphere. No significant changes in DA function were seen in the putamen. Volumetric analysis of putamenal NTN labeling showed between-subject variation, with tissue distribution ranging from 214 to 744 mm3, approximately equivalent to 27–93% of area coverage. Our results support the concept that intraparenchymal delivery of NTN protein may be effective for the treatment of PD. More studies are needed to determine strategies that would enhance tissue distribution of exogenous NTN protein, which could contribute to optimize its trophic effects in the parkinsonian brain.

Abstract
OBJECTIVE To study the clinical features and diagnosis of intrahepatic cholestasis of pregnancy (ICP). METHODS During the last 10 years 1241 cases of ICP stayed in our hospital. Their clinical data were retrospectively reviewed. RESULTS 5.2% of all the maternity patients had ICP. It occurred more in winter and 3.5% of ICP occurred in multiple pregnancies. The recurrence rate of ICP was 30.2%. On the average, it occurred at gestational week 32.6. Skin pruritus was the characteristic manifestation and the presenting symptom in 1201 patients (96.8%). The other presenting features included elevated serum ALT and AST (2.3%), jaundice (8 patients), diarrhea (3 patients), deep yellow urine (2 patients) and right upper abdominal pain (1 patient). The serum transaminases levels were elevated, of which 60% were between 50-200 IU/L. Serum total bile acid (TBA) levels were elevated in 82.4% of the patients and bilirubin levels in 33.4%. The elevated bilirubin levels were 30 to 90 micromol/L in 85% of those patients with this condition, and it was never higher than 170 micromol/L. CONCLUSION The basic diagnostic points of ICP are pruritus and abnormal liver function characterized by increased transaminases and TBA. Therefore paying attention to typical pruritus and other atypical features such as elevated serum transaminases, jaundice, diarrhea, deep yellow urine and right upper abdominal pain during antenatal care is important for an early diagnosis of ICP.

Abstract
Nestin is an intermediate filament protein serving as a marker for neuroprogenitor and stem cells. Here we report that a cluster of previously unrecognized nestin immunoreactive (nestin-ir) neurons was located in the medial septum-diagonal band of Broca (MS-DBB) of the basal forebrain in adult rats. Nestin-ir neurons were exclusively located in the MS-DBB and intermingled with choline acetyltransferase-ir (ChAT-ir), parvalbumin-ir (PV-ir), or nicotinamide adenine dinucleotide phosphate (NADPH)-diaphorase reactive (NADPHd-reactive) neurons. However, there was no colocalization between nestin-ir and PV-ir in single neurons in MS-DBB; only about 35% of nestin-ir neurons were ChAT-ir, and 8%-12% of nestin-ir neurons were NADPHd-reactive. Morphologically, nestin-ir neurons showed a larger size of somata than that of ChAT-ir or PV-ir neurons and the distribution of nestin-ir neurons spread across the rostro-caudal extent of the MS-DBB. Moreover, retrograde tracing revealed that a significant portion of these nestin-ir neurons projected to the thalamus and hippocampus. These results, for the first time, provide strong evidence that there exists a cluster of previously unrecognized nestin-ir neurons in MS-DBB of the basal forebrain in adult rats and that these nestin-ir neurons are distinguishable from ChAT-ir, PV-ir, and NADPHd-reactive neurons.

Abstract
OBJECTIVE To study the perinatal outcomes of intrahepatic cholestasis of pregnancy (ICP). METHODS The clinical data of 1210 cases of ICP in recent ten years were retrospectively analyzed. RESULTS The incidence rates of perinatal outcomes of ICP were as follows: 19.0% (230/1210) for threatened premature labor, 24.0% (290/1210) for premature delivery; 23.2% (281/1210) for meconium stained amniotic fluid, 7.1% (86/1210) for neonatal asphyxia, 22.5 per thousand (27/1210) for perinatal mortality, 85.9% (1039/1210) for cesarean section, 0.9% (11/1210) for fetal growth restriction (FGR), 1.4% (17/1210) for postpartum hemorrhage, and 8.1% (101/1210) for preeclampsia. Threatened premature labor occurred beyond the gestation gestation period of 32 weeks in 88.7% (204/230) of the patients, and the fetal death rate in threatened premature labor was 46.7% (7/15). Premature delivery occurred after 34 weeks of gestation in 96.2% of the patients (279/290) 89.7% (260/290) of which were caused by cesarean section because of abnormal fetal monitoring. 41.3% of the cases with meconium stained amniotic fluid (116/281) occurred before the onset of labor. Fetal death accounted for 56% (15/27) of perinatal death, 80% (12/15) of which happened after the gestation week of 35 (36.5 +/- 1.2) with normal fetal heart rate monitoring. 95% (19/20) of the fetal death and stillbirth occurred after threatened premature labor and occasional uterine contractions, or at the early stage of labor. CONCLUSION The rates of FGR, postpartum hemorrhage, and preeclampsia in ICP are almost the same as those of the normal pregnancy. Routine fetal heart rate monitoring methods cannot predict fetal death. The important measures to decrease the perinatal mortality include paying attention to fetal monitoring when threatened premature labor, occasional uterine contractions and prenatal meconium occur, and at the early stage of labor, and management of threatened premature labor and timely intervention of pregnancy (at the gestation period of 34 - 37 weeks).

Abstract
OBJECTIVE To investigate the influence of transforming growth factor-beta2 (TGF-beta2) on production of tumor necrosis factor-alpha (TNF-alpha) and interferon-gamma (IFN-gamma) from placenta of patients with intrahepatic cholestasis of pregnancy (ICP). METHODS Villous explants from 10 ICP patients (ICP group) and 10 normal gravidae (control group) were cultured in vitro. The concentrations of TNF-alpha and IFN-gamma in the culture medium were determined by enzyme linked immunoadsorbent assay (ELISA) after incubation with different concentrations of TGF-beta2 for 1, 24 and 48 hours. RESULTS (1) After cultured for 1, 24 and 48 hours, TNF-alpha level in ICP group was (771 +/- 187) pg/g, (2 490 +/- 575) pg/g, and (3339 +/- 1106) pg/g, respectively, while IFN-gamma level was (931 +/- 148) pg/g, (1888 +/- 545) pg/g, and (3027 +/- 667) pg/g, respectively. All were significantly higher than those in the normal group (P < 0.001). (2) TGF-beta2 could inhibit the release of above cytokines in a time- and dose-dependent manner: TNF-alpha level was (2490 +/- 575) pg/g, (1806 +/- 502) pg/g, and (1231 +/- 238) pg/g after 24 h, (3339 +/- 1106) pg/g, (2168 +/- 794) pg/g, and (1047 +/- 183) pg/g after 48 h, respectively; IFN-gamma level was (1888 +/- 545) pg/g, (1 347 +/- 405) pg/g, and (913 +/- 303) pg/g after 24 h, and (3027 +/- 667) pg/g, (2062 +/- 795) pg/g, and (1001 +/- 301) pg/g after 48 h, respectively. CONCLUSION (1) The excessive production of TH1 type cytokines TNF-alpha and IFN-gamma may involve in the pathogenesis of ICP; (2) TGF-beta2 may exert immunoprotection effect through inhibiting the production of TNF-alpha and IFN-gamma.

Abstract
OBJECTIVE To investigate the clinical characteristics of intrahepatic cholestasis of pregnancy (ICP). METHODS Totally 1241 cases of ICP during the 10 years from Jan 1991 to Dec 2000 in our hospital were retrospectively reviewed. RESULTS Forty-four (3.5%) patients were multiple gestation. One hundred and one (8.1%) patients had pregnancy induced hypertension. ICP recurred in 30.2% multipara (38/126). On average, it occurred at gestational week of 32.6. Pruritus was the first symptom in 1201 (96.8%) patients while 8 (0.6%) patients had jaundice and 28 (2.3%) patients had abnormal liver function at the onset. Serum total bile acid (TBA), alanine aminotransferase (ALT) and aspartate aminotransferase (AST) levels were usually mild or moderately elevated, while some patients had normal TBA (17.7%), ALT (15.6%), or AST (17.1%) level. The albumin/globulin ratio was reversed in 35 (3.2%) patients. CONCLUSION ICP tends to recur in subsequent pregnancy. It is more likely to develop in multiple gestation. Pruritus is the most common and prominent manifestation. Elevated TBA and ALT or AST level is helpful for diagnosis. It should be noted that the above manifestations might not be typical in some patients.

Abstract
The clinical features of 76 multiple-trauma patients in the intensive care unit were observed with acute physiology and chronic health evaluation (APACHE II) system. The results showed that the mean value of APACHE II scores in 76 patients was 18.4; the mean duration of staying at the ICU was 91.5 hours. Six patients died in the ICU (7.9%), 13 patients were complicated with MODS (17.1%), and 10 patients developed ARDS (13.2%). As APAHCE II scores increased, the duration of the patient staying at the ICU lengthened and the mortality went up.

Abstract
OBJECTIVE To study the effects of tissue expansion on tissue damage and retrograde degeneration. METHODS 9 cases of conventional intermittent tissue expansion (CITE) and 9 cases of continuous pressure-controlled tissue expansion (CPTE) were chosen for the study. In creating of the expanded flaps, tissue samples were taken for histopathology, molecular biology and transmission electron microscope (TEM) examinations. RESULTS Capillary bleeding, elastic and reticular fiber proliferation, arteriole thrombosis, fibroblast apoptosis and collagenolysis were observed after expansion. Retrograde degeneration was obvious in CITE group and acute lesion was obvious in CPTE group. CONCLUSION Expansion stimulation induces tissue damage and retrograde degeneration, which indicates that the time for conventional intermittent expansion should be shortened and too fast continuous expansion is harmful.

Abstract
Time-lapsed video microscopy and confocal imaging were used to study the migration of wild-type (WT) and mitogen-activated protein kinase-activated protein kinase 2 (MK2-/-) mouse neutrophils in Zigmond chambers containing fMLP gradients. Confocal images of polarized WT neutrophils showed an intracellular gradient of phospho-MK2 from the anterior to the posterior region of the neutrophils. Compared with WT neutrophils, MK2-/- neutrophils showed a partial loss of directionality but higher migration speed. Immunoblotting experiments showed a lower protein level of p38 mitogen-activated protein kinase and a loss of fMLP-induced extracellular signal-related kinase phosphorylation in MK2-/- neutrophils. These results suggest that MK2 plays an important role in the regulation of neutrophil migration and may also affect other signaling molecules.

Abstract
Leukocyte-specific gene 1 protein (LSP1) is a cytoskeletal-associated protein of leukocytes that in vitro cross-links F-actin into extensively branched bundles of mixed polarity. In this study, we examined chemotaxis and superoxide production in neutrophils prepared from wild-type (WT) and Lsp1 knockout mice. Compared to WT neutrophils, Lsp1-/- neutrophils showed impairment in both migration speed and chemotaxis direction during chemokine KC-directed chemotaxis. When examined by confocal microscopy, chemotaxing Lsp1-/- neutrophils showed abnormal morphologies. They had discontinuous primary actin-rich cortexes and large membrane protrusions. When stimulated by phorbol 12-myristate 13-acetate (PMA), Lsp1-/- peritoneal neutrophils produce more superoxide than WT. The data presented suggest that LSP1 plays important roles in the regulation of neutrophil morphology, motility, and superoxide production.

Abstract
OBJECTIVE To investigate the interpupillary distance (IPD) of Chinese children for stipulating the sizes for children spectacle frames. METHOD The IPD of 10171 children aged 5 to 17 years old was measured with a caliper in four cities. RESULTS The IPD was positively correlated with the age increase from 5 to 17 years. The IPD in males was larger than that in females. The differences of IPD between males and females in the age groups of 5 to 9 and 10 to 15 years were statistically significant (F = 400.97, P < 0.01). CONCLUSIONS There are two peak periods of the growth of IPD in Chinese children at 5 to 9 and 10 to 15 years. The IPD in males reaches adult level at age 15 and in females at age 13. The differences of the IPD between male and female and among 4 cities have no practical meaning in stipulating the sizes of children spectacle frames.

Abstract
Galactokinase (GK; EC 2.7.1.6) is the first enzyme in the metabolism of galactose. In humans, GK deficiency results in congenital cataracts due to an accumulation of galactitol within the lens. In an attempt to make a galactosemic animal model, we cloned the mouse GK gene (Glk1) and disrupted it by gene targeting. As expected, galactose was very poorly metabolized in GK-deficient mice. In addition, both galactose and galactitol accumulated in tissues of GK-deficient mice. Surprisingly, the GK-deficient animals did not form cataracts even when fed a high galactose diet. However, the introduction of a human aldose reductase transgene into a GK-deficient background resulted in cataract formation within the first postnatal day. This mouse represents the first mouse model for congenital galactosemic cataract.

Abstract
Deficiencies in neutrophil NADPH oxidase proteins have been demonstrated in humans with chronic granulomatous disease. However, no spontaneous mutation in murine NADPH oxidase has been reported. In this study we report that neutrophils from the diabetic mouse strains, C57BL/6J-m heterozygous lean (lepr(db/+)) and homozygous obese (lepr(db/db)) mice produced no superoxide on stimulation. An absence of intact p47(phox) but not other oxidase proteins was observed in both mouse strains through the use of immunoblotting. Molecular analysis by reverse transcriptase-polymerase chain reaction identified three abnormal p47phox mRNA transcripts. Sequencing of genomic DNA of p47(phox) revealed a point mutation at the -2 position of exon 8, which is consistent with aberrant splicing of the p47(phox) transcript. These results indicate that the C57BL/6J-m db/db and db/+ mice are the first spontaneously derived murine model of NADPH oxidase deficiency involving a p47(phox) mutation.

Abstract
A full-term baby was born to an epileptic mother treated with two anti-epileptic drugs, sodium valproate and phenobarbital, throughout the pregnancy. She was given no information about the risk of teratogenesis of these drugs. At birth the patient was hypotonic and had clinical features specific for the fetal valproate syndrome. After a viral infection at three months of age, he had intractable and persistent wheezing. Suspecting the presence of congenital respiratory tract abnormality, we performed tracheobronchoscopy, which revealed a relatively big submucosal tumor on the left trachial wall below the vocal cord. Dyspnea and wheezing were remarkably improved by tracheolaryngotomy, but he died suddenly and unexplainedly at seven months of age.

Abstract
A medium with camphor and benomyl MCBL plate was designed and constructed based on the proposed mechanism that d-camphor could induce the fusion of nuclear membrane while benomyl could induce the nondisjunctional recombination of chromosome in fungi. This so-called co-induction plate consisted of 0.1% d-camphor (W/V) and 0.5 microgram/L benomyl contained in Czapek's minimal medium. The precautions to be taken in the construction procedure of this plate was described in detail. One typical example of intergeneric fusion-cross, Aspergillus niger x Trichoderma reesei, was investigated, comparing the ratios of genotypes and phenotypes of fusant progenies produced by the co-induction of MCBL plate and by the step-by-step induction with camphor and benomyl separately. The results showed that the heterodiploid state was extremely transient and the recombinant haploid was hardly obtained when induced by the routine step-by-step method, whereas the ratios of apparent diplodization and nondisjunctional recombinant haplodization among all types of varied segregates on MCBL plate were greatly improved, compared with those on the routine plates containing single reagents, which indicated that the transient heterodiploid could be grasped and transformed further into nondisjunctional recombinant haploid when co-induced on the MCBL plate. The age of regenerated mycelium to be induced was found to have a dominant influence on the co-induction effects of MCBL plate. The mechanism of co-induction by MCBL plate and its promising applications were discussed.

Abstract
Dopamine neurons in the substantia nigra of the midbrain are the primary neuronal population affected by 1-methyl-4-phenyl-1,2,3, 6-tetrahydropyridine (MPTP) toxicity, which produces the pathological and behavioral features of Parkinson's disease in nonhuman primates and man. We have identified another injury site in magnetic resonance imaging (MRI) brain scans in 13 of 37 rhesus monkeys taken 10-12 months after administration of this neurotoxin via the right carotid artery. Focal lesions, ranging in volume from 6.75 to 60 mm3 in the rostral globus pallidus region, were seen on the right side of the brain in these 13 animals in addition to the midbrain effects. While no significant differences were seen between globus pallidus lesioned and nonlesioned animals in the severity of MPTP-induced parkinsonian symptoms, the response to levodopa was muted in pallidal-lesioned animals. To confirm the role of neurotoxicity in producing the lesions, brain scans from an additional 12 monkeys were evaluated during the acute period following exposure to either MPTP (n = 6) or saline (n = 6). Focal lesions in the rostral globus pallidus were seen as early as 2-4 h following a carotid artery infusion in two of six MPTP recipients, but no evidence of injury was seen in saline recipients. The globus pallidus includes important components of the neural circuitry regulating motor functions. The present results indicate that in addition to midbrain dopamine neurons, a focal region of the rostral globus pallidus is selectively vulnerable to MPTP toxicity.

Abstract
OBJECTIVE To examine the effect of human herpesvirus 6(HHV-6) on the replication of Epstein-Barr virus (EBV) in cell lines. METHODS Both EBV-infected Raji cells and EBV-transformed lymphoblastoid cell lines (LCL) were infected with HHV-6. Immunofluoresence assay (IFA) with monoclonal antibodies (MAb) against HHV-6 was applied to confirm the infection of HHV-6 in the two cell lines. Expression of EBV antigen was examined by IFA using human anti-EBV serum. RESULTS Following HHV-6 infection, cytopathic effects (CPE) were observed in Raji cells but not in LCL. HHV-6 were detected in both cell lines by IFA with anti-HHV-6 MAb, but not in controls. EBV antigens were detected by IFA with human serum against EBV in both HHV-6 infected cell lines. CONCLUSION Data in this study suggest that HHV-6 promotes the expression of EBV antigen and may contribute to the pathogenesis of nasopharyngeal carcinoma in cooperation with EBV.

Abstract
By using the developed display techniques of cellulase isozymes and the RAPD-PCR analysis guided by a deduced universal sequence of cellulase genes, the polymorphisms of genomic DNA fingerprints and cellulase isozymes were compared among three typical stable recombinants (3a, 3b, A7-1) and their two parents (Aspergillus niger AMS11, Trichoderma reesei QM9414) in order to provide the molecular evidence of gene recombination, to demonstrate the compatibility of heredity and expression of intergeneric genomes, and to assay on the molecular fundamentals of hybridization dominance. The results showed that in these recombinant strains the recombinantal fingerprints of genomic DNA could be stablly hereditary and the expression of recombinantal CMCase (carboxymethylcellulase) and beta GLase (beta-glucosidase) could be compatibly enhanced. The diversity of molecular fundamentals of cellulase hybridization dominance were (1) the compatible co-existence and enhanced expression of some hereditary beta GLase-coding genes from two parents in recombinant 3b; and (2) the compatibly enhancement of expression between the hereditary genes encoding beta GLase and CMCase from two parents, resulting in the dramatic increase of proteins of corresponding isozymes in recombinants 3a and A7-1. Based on these, a proposal model for the double synergism on cellulase activity in vitro and on its biosynthesis in vivo mediated by beta GLase was suggested. A practical method for assaying on the molecular fundamentals and the stability of hybridization dominance of recombinants was thereby established in this study.

Abstract
Transforming growth factor-beta 1 (TGF-beta 1) is the strongest chemoattractant yet described for human neutrophils. It activates neither phospholipase C nor phospholipase D. It does not induce rises in intracellular calcium, degranulation, or superoxide production. The signaling pathways utilized by TGF-beta 1 are largely unknown. This report demonstrates that TGF-beta 1 activates p38 MAP kinase. The kinase inhibitor SB203580 blocks the chemotactic responses as well as actin polymerization induced by TGF-beta 1. Potential cellular targets of the p38 MAP kinase pathway which could mediate these function are discussed.

Abstract
Comparisons of the kinetics of mycelium growth, cellulase biosynthesis, and the degradation of filter paper to accumulate reducing-sugar by the filtrates of cultures were carried out among the recombinant strain ATH-1376 and its two parents, Aspergillus niger AMS11 and Trichoderma reesei QM9414. The results showed that both the specific mycelium growth rate and the cellulase biosynthesis rate of the recombinant were dramatically dominant over those of the two parents. In addition, the negative correlation between the specific mycelium growth rate and the cellulase biosynthesis rate of the recombinant ATH-1376 was much lower than those of its parents. In terms of the amount of reducing-sugar accumulated from the hydrolysis of filter paper by culture filtrates, there were great differences among the three different treatments, i.e., fermentation filtrate of single parental strain, mixture of the fermentation filtrates from two parental strains with different ratios (v:v), and filtrate from the mixed culture of the two parental strains. Out of these, the second approach, particularly with the ratio of 1:1, was best for the accumulation of reducing sugar. Within various tested periods of enzymic hydrolysis, the amounts of reducing-sugar produced by the recombinant were 1.19 to 2.26 times as much as the maximum amounts produced in parallel by the mixture of filtrates (1:1) from separate fermentations of the two parental strains. These results suggested that constructing the engineered strains with hybridization dominance of these two typical genera of far-heredity could be effective to overcome the great deficiencies of routine mixculture, single-strain fermentation, or double fed-batch fermentations.
